Folder in the start menu. XP has a few start folders so look in all of them.
C:\Documents and Settings\[UserName]\Start Menu\Programs\Startup
H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Run
H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\RunOnce
And a few more keys under then

Right click on the folder & choose properties. With that, you can go to the location it is supposed to be. If it's not there (probably not), go back & right click, this time choose delete: should delete it from start up.
